Prompt:

Much of the novel White Noise deals thematically with death and finality. 

In Part II we are introduced to a toxic agent, Nyodene D., which after exposure during the "event" stamps Gladney with certain death (as if it wasn't already). 

In Part III., Gladney becomes obsessed with Dylar, a mysterious pharmaceutical pill taken by Babette.

In a 1-2 page response, explore the effects these two technologies have had on Gladney and his family. Discuss what possible commentary DeLillo is making on technology in American culture by what is happening to Jack and/or his family.

Do not generalize or stick simply to summary of the chapters. I do not expect you to be able to discuss everything that is happening. Rather, focus your argument on one major point and develop that over the 1-2 pages, using textual evidence (cite page numbers).
